Put it in the category the best fits it and get over the notion that sex in a story is any kind of requirement here.

As I have shown in multiple threads on this subject, there are thousands of stories here; popular stories with high scores and lots of views that contain little or no sex at all. Zilch. Nada.

One I frequently reference is "You Can Go Home Again", posted in Loving Wives by blackrandl1958. It's been here since 2017 and retains its red H easily. You could also refer to several of my stories, especially in the N/N category. Well received, fine scores, good feedback and no sex.

If it's a break-up story (and let's face it, that happens a lot in real life) you may get some grumblings from Romance readers. I tend to put those in Non-erotic even if that is not quite accurate as a label. If it's a relatively happy story, then it should work well in Romance.
